Napkin AI turns plain text into editable visuals - diagrams, flowcharts, infographics, mind maps - in about five seconds. Built by two ex-Google engineers who previously co-founded the children's learning platform Osmo, Napkin uses an orchestrator LLM and a 'design agency' of specialized sub-agents to do the work most knowledge workers used to outsource to a designer or a PowerPoint smart-art menu.
Prezi is a cloud-based visual communication company best known for inventing the zooming, non-linear presentation - an open-canvas alternative to slide-by-slide decks. Founded in Budapest in 2009 and now dual-headquartered in San Francisco and Budapest, Prezi has grown into a full suite spanning Prezi Present, Prezi Video (presenter-on-screen overlays), Prezi Design/Infograms, and Prezi AI. More than 160 million people have used it to create roughly 400 million presentations.
